Udio - An AI song generator that turns text prompts into complete songs

1. What is Udio, and how does it work?

Udio is an AI music generator that creates complete songs from text descriptions. Built by former Google DeepMind engineers, it produces tracks with vocals, instrumentation, and realistic emotion in under a minute. The platform handles everything from pop ballads to hip-hop bangers, with support for multiple languages and vocal styles.

How it works:

→ Users write a text prompt describing the genre, mood, and theme (like ""upbeat electronic dance track with synths"").

→ Choose between auto-generated lyrics, custom lyrics, or instrumental-only tracks.

→ Udio generates a 30-second clip, which you can extend, remix, or edit using stems.

Ideal for: Musicians at all skill levels, from Grammy-winning producers to hobbyists creating personalized tracks for special occasions.

3. Can Udio's AI song generator create songs with custom lyrics and vocals?

Yes. Udio gives you three options for lyrics:

Custom Lyrics: Write your own (200-350 characters recommended for 30-second clips). Use tags like [Verse], [Chorus], or [Guitar Solo] to structure your song.

Auto-generated: Let the AI write lyrics based on your prompt.

Instrumental: Generate music without vocals.

The vocal synthesis works across male and female voices, harmonies, and genres from soul to metalcore. You can also edit lyrics mid-creation using the lyric editor if pronunciation or phrasing needs adjustment.

Result: Full control over your song's narrative and vocal delivery, with the flexibility to refine as you go.

4. Verdict and short comparison with Suno and Soundraw:

Udio delivers polished vocal and instrumental songs with strong editing control, appealing to creators seeking.

Suno generates quick, accessible songs with basic editing features, ideal for fast drafting and experimentation.

Soundraw creates customizable instrumental tracks for videos and podcasts, prioritizing workflow speed over songwriting capabilities.

5. What are some use cases for Udio?

Udio works for a wide range of projects:

Music Production: Songwriters use it for ideation, generating stems for commercial releases, or creating reference tracks.

Personal Projects: Create custom songs for birthdays, weddings, romantic dates, or meditation playlists.

Content Creation: YouTubers, podcasters, and social media creators generate royalty-free music for videos and intros.

Community Sharing: Publish tracks on Udio's platform to build a following and discover new music from other creators.

Users include: Independent artists, DJs, producers working on commercial releases, and hobbyists exploring music creation without traditional instruments.

Final Thoughts

Udio stands out for its vocal realism and editing flexibility, making it a strong choice for anyone who wants to create complete songs with emotional depth. The platform's extension and remix features let you build full-length tracks from 30-second clips, while stem separation appeals to producers who want to fine-tune individual elements. For purely instrumental background music without vocals, Soundraw might be simpler. But if you want to tell stories through music with realistic singing, Udio delivers.
